Why this kit matters
The Messerschmitt Me262B-1a/U1 "Nachtjäger" was the world’s first operational jet-powered night fighter, developed by Germany during the final years of the Second World War. Equipped with advanced radar and flown by skilled crews, it was designed to intercept Allied bombers under cover of darkness, marking a significant leap in aerial warfare technology.
This two-seat variant featured a radar operator and specialised nose-mounted radar antennas, making it a rare and fascinating subject for modellers. Only a handful were built, and their unique role in history makes them a standout addition to any aircraft collection.
